Wikipedia - Rangdajied United FC

Rangdajied United Football Club (formerly known as Ar-Hima) is an Indian professional football club based in Mawngap-Mawphlang, in the south-west of Shillong, East Khasi Hills, Meghalaya. The club was founded in 1987, and participated in I-League 2nd Division. IY won the league in the 2012–13 season.

Rangdajied was in the then top tier league in the country, I-league, during the 2013–14 season. The club consecutively participates in Shillong Premier League, the top tier state football league in Meghalaya.

History

Rangdajied United was founded in 1987 as Ar-Hima. The club has participated in various editions of the Shillong Premier League and enjoyed massive rivalries with their fellow Shillong based clubs Shillong Lajong and Royal Wahingdoh.

The club has participated in the 2013 I-League 2nd Division and qualified for the main round. Having won the 2013 I-League 2nd Division final round held at Bangalore, Rangdajied qualified for the I-League. On 20 November 2013, Rangdajied agreed the signings of India national team stars Gouramangi Singh, Subrata Pal, Sandesh Jhingan, Manandeep Singh, and Tomba Singh, and competed in the 2013–14 season. They finished as 11th in the league table with 25 points in 24 matches. In the following season Rangdajied was evicted from I-League for not fulfilling the Asian Football Confederation's club licensing criteria.

After clinching the 2013 edition of Shillong Premier League, Rangdajied finished as runners-up in 2016 season. In 2015–16 season, the club was managed by Khlain Pyrkhat Syiemlieh, who cleared the AFC A licence at that time. Rangdajied then became a regular participant in Meghalaya State League, formed in 2017. Later in 2019 season, they again achieved runners-up position, gaining 22 points in 12 matches. The club finished as runners-up in second edition of the Meghalaya State League. In June 2023, Rangdajied clinched their first ever Meghalaya State League title, defeating Khliehmawlieh YC in final. In November of the same year, the club returned to the nationwide league, joining newly formed I-League 3. Later on 10 November, club CEO Andrew Suting officially announced Meghalaya Tourism as main sponsor, stating, "The support from Meghalaya Tourism will undoubtedly contribute to the growth and development of the football club while simultaneously drawing attention to the treasures of the state."

In August 2023, Rangdajied United gained I-League 3 spot to compete in the inaugural edition. They began the league campaign on 13 November in Goa, beating Millat FC 5–0 in Group C.
